DEPARTMENT OF HEALTH AND HUMAN SERVICES

Centers for Disease Control and Prevention

Disease, Disability, and Injury Prevention and Control Special

Emphasis Panel (SEP): Spina Bifida Patient Registry Demonstration

Project (U01), Program Announcement Number (PA) DP 08-001

In accordance with section 10(a)(2) of the Federal Advisory

Committee Act (Pub. L. 92-463), the Centers for Disease Control and

Prevention (CDC) announces the aforementioned meeting.

Time and Date: 8 a.m.-5 p.m., July 10, 2008 (Closed).

Place: Grand Hyatt Atlanta, 3300 Peachtree Road, NE., Atlanta,

GA 30305, Telephone: (404) 237-1234.

Status: The meeting will be closed to the public in accordance with provisions set forth in section 552b(c)(4) and (6), Title 5

U.S.C., and the Determination of the Director, Management Analysis and Services Office, CDC, pursuant to Public Law 92-463.

Matters To Be Discussed: The meeting will include the review, discussion, and evaluation of applications received in response to

``Spina Bifida Patient Registry Demonstration Project (U01), PA DP 08-001.''
